Order by where顺序
WebSELECT * FROM posts GROUP BY tid ORDER BY dateline DESC LIMIT 10. 这条语句选出来的结果和上面的完全一样,不过把结果倒序排列了,而选择出来的每一条记录仍然是上面的记录,原因是 group by 会比 order by 先执行,这样也就没有办法将 group by 之前,也就是在分组之前进行排序 ... WebMySql中,order by 多个字段时,按字段先后顺序排优先级。 以上的示例中,我们只使用了两个字段,下面使用三个字段验证一下这个规则。 (1)按sAge升序、sGrade降序、sStuId …
Order by where顺序
Did you know?
WebMar 25, 2024 · 其实除了group by获取分组最后一个记录之外,还可以通过关联子查询方式来实现: select id,name from tt a where id = (select max(id) from tt where name = a.name) order by name // 输出结果如下 id,name 2,name1 4,name2 通过以上group by和关联子查询两种方式的实现,获取分组的最后一条记录要么直接通过分组直接来获取,要么先获取到记 … WebApr 13, 2024 · 排序规则如下:. 每一个过滤器都必须指定一个int类型的order值, order值越小,优先级越高,执行顺序越靠前 。. GlobalFilter通过实现Ordered接口, 或者添 …
Web1.order作“次序,顺序”“治安,秩序”“整齐,有条理”解时,既可用作可数名词,也可用作不可数名词。 作“订购,订货”“命令,嘱咐”“汇票,汇单”解时,只用作可数名词。 2.order的复数形式orders可指一条命令,可接动词不定式或that从句作定语,也可接that从句,中心谓语动词要用虚拟式。 3.order在表示“勋章”时,要带定冠词the,order的第一个字母要大写,其后接of。 4.order作“…级”“种类”“ … 若要查看 SQL Server 2014 及更早版本的 Transact-SQL 语法,请参阅 早期版本文档 。 See more
WebFeb 3, 2009 · ORDER BY is the only way to sort the rows in the result set. Without this clause, the relational database system may return the rows in any order. If an ordering is required, the ORDER BY must be provided in the SELECT statement sent by the application. WebYou have to use the Order By at the end of ALL the unions。 the ORDER BY is considered to apply to the whole UNION result (it's effectively got lower binding priority than the UNION). The ORDER BY clause just needs to be the last statement, after …
WebORDER BY. ORDER BY 子句包含一个表达式列表,每个表达式都可以用 DESC (降序)或 ASC (升序)修饰符确定排序方向。 如果未指定方向, 默认是 ASC ,所以它通常被省略。 …
WebFeb 8, 2024 · ORDER BY满足以下情况,会使用Index方式排序: a)ORDER BY 语句使用索引最左前列。 参见第1句 b)使用Where子句与Order BY子句条件列组合满足索引最左前列。 参见第2句. 以下情况,会使用FileSort方式的查询 a)检查的行数过多,且没有使用覆盖索引。 第3句,虽然跟第2句一样,order by使用了索引最左前列uid,但依然使用了filesort方式排序, … fisher 5d pearl shadowWeborder by 子句的目的是按一列或多列对查询结果进行排序。 同时,GROUP BY 子句用于借助诸如 COUNT()、AVG()、MIN() 和 MAX() 之类的聚合函数将数据分组。 它的工作方式是,如果特定的列在不同的行中具有相同的值,它会将这些行合并为一组。 fisher 5 volumetric flaskWebORDER BY 子句包含一个表达式列表,每个表达式都可以用 DESC (降序)或 ASC (升序)修饰符确定排序方向。 如果未指定方向, 默认是 ASC ,所以它通常被省略。 排序方向适用于单个表达式,而不适用于整个列表。 示例: ORDER BY Visits DESC, SearchPhrase 对于排序表达式列表具有相同值的行以任意顺序输出,也可以是非确定性的(每次都不同)。 如 … canada has hosted the olympic games 4 timesWeb分组查询列表,分组查到的那条数据必须是最新的。 group by与order by同时使用,order by不起作用。 通过查询博客文档,才知道group by执行顺序在order by之前,先进行分组,已经得到了分组后的数据,排序没有起作用。 使用子查询和max()函数取出分… canada has too much geographyWebApr 6, 2024 · ORDER BY 是可选的。 但是,如果希望按排序后的顺序显示数据,那么必须使用 ORDER BY。 默认的排序顺序是升序(A 到 Z,0 到 9)。 以下的两个示例均以姓氏的 … fisher 5 disc cd changerWeb对于 order by 查询,带或者不带 limit 可能返回行的顺序是不一样的。 如果 limit row_count 与 order by 一起使用,那么在找到第一个 row_count 就停止排序,直接返回。 如果 order by 列有相同的值,那么 MySQL 可以自由地以任何顺序返回这些行。 换言之,只要 order by 列的值不重复,就可以保证返回的顺序。 可以在 order by 子句中包含附加列,以使顺序具 … canada has how many provincesWebORDER BY 子句允许: 对单个列或多个列排序结果集。 按升序或降序对不同列的结果集进行排序。 下面说明了 ORDER BY 子句的语法: SELECT column1, column2,... FROM tbl ORDER BY column1 [ASC DESC], column2 [ASC DESC],... ASC 表示升序, DESC 表示降序。 默认情况下,如果不明确指定 ASC 或 DESC , ORDER BY 子句会按照升序对结果集进行排序。 下 … fisher 5s